Benjamín Vicuña revealed what started his fight with China Suárez

The actor broke his silence after his ex-partner's explosive accusations

The peace between Benjamín Vicuña and Eugenia "la China" Suárez appears to have come to an end. After years of cordial agreements regarding the upbringing of their children Magnolia and Amancio, a series of social media posts by the actress sparked a new phase of public tension between them.

Everything began weeks ago, when la China shared a post in which, ironically, she referred to Vicuña as "father of the year" and accused him of being an absent father, in addition to insinuating that he had addiction problems. The post caused a major stir on social media and in the press, and although it was deleted some time later, the controversy had already taken hold.

Vicuña's response: "It was food for social media"

Until now, Vicuña had avoided speaking directly about his ex-partner's statements. However, in a recent interview given to the Chilean magazine Velvet—shared in Argentina by the program LAM—the actor broke his silence and referred to the conflict as "regrettable."

"With her, while separated, we had for years a harmonious, flexible arrangement, based on understanding, affection, and respect", he began. According to his explanation, what broke that harmony was precisely the public exposure of differences that had previously been solved in private.

"Today we have to go through this painful situation... but I'm going to keep betting on understanding between adults, for the sake of the children", assured the Chilean actor, making it clear that his priority remains the emotional stability of his children.

When asked about the content of la China Suárez's post, Vicuña avoided responding with direct confrontation. Instead, he chose to focus on his role as a father: "I want to be the father my children need. A father with good days and bad days, with mistakes, real and close."

He added firmly: "I know who I am and my children know who I am". With these words, the actor sought to dismiss the accusations and reaffirm his commitment to fatherhood beyond the conflicts with his ex-partner.

Finally, he downplayed the scope of the controversy: "This was just food for social media. That's where it came from and that's where it dies", he stated, making it clear that he doesn't intend to escalate the conflict publicly.
